About Toolport
Toolport is a free, open source local gateway that sits between every AI client you use and every MCP server you run. Set up and authenticate a server once in Toolport and it shows up in Claude, Cursor, VS Code, Codex and 15+ other clients, with hot toggles and no restarts. No more pasting the same config and API key into five different tools. It also fixes the MCP token tax. Instead of every server dumping its full tool list into context on every request, Toolport exposes a handful of meta-tools your agent searches on demand. Measured on a frontier model and graded for correct answers, that's up to 91% fewer tool tokens at the same task success. Security is local by default. Toolport fingerprints every tool and flags rug pulls (a definition changing after you approved it) and tool poisoning (hidden instructions in a description). Your API keys live in your OS keychain, never in a client config and never in the cloud. Destructive tool calls can require your approval before they run. Runs on Windows, macOS and Linux. No account, no cloud, MIT licensed.

Does it works with local LLMs / cloud LLMs?
@viciousse Both. Toolport doesn't run the model, it sits between your client and your MCP servers, so it works with whatever your client uses. Cloud models via Claude, Cursor, Codex, etc., and local ones through Open WebUI
